Repubs debate in PA3
Dan Hirshhorn at Pa2010 went to the District 3 GOP congressional debate at Allegheny College last night, and describes an atmosphere that echoes the Corbett-Rohrer story we highlighted earlier -- candidates who agree on most major issues (anti HCR, stimulus, Obama, etc) so have to carve out stylistic differences:
In the end, the debate was most illuminating for its stylistic contrasts. Kelly appeared to be the charismatic every-man to Huber’s policy wonk. Grabb and Moore were the fiery populists, while Fisher and Franz were the reserved candidates, moderate in rhetoric if not always in policy positions.
